A wiry outgrowth on a plant arising from in between the leaf and stem can be an axillary stem tendril.
Stem tendrils:
a. Tendrils are thin, wiry, photosynthetic, leafless coiled structures.
b. They give additional support to developing plant.
c. Tendrils have adhesive glands for fixation.
